Breaking Down The Terms: Who Holds The Design

The cleanest way to separate the two models comes down to one question: who holds the design and the patent?

With OEM, the brand supplies the drawings and sets the specifications. The factory builds exactly to those files. The brand owns the look, the structure, and any intellectual property tied to it. The manufacturer acts as the production arm.

With ODM, the factory offers a finished, proven design. The brand makes light changes such as color, logo placement, or minor trim, then puts the product on the market under its own label. The design ownership stays largely with the maker.

Neither is better in the abstract. OEM gym equipment gives full control and a defensible product identity. ODM gym equipment gives speed and a lower research burden. The right pick depends on where a brand stands and what it wants to protect.

Matching The Model To Your Growth Stage

Growth stage is the most useful filter here.

A startup or a regional dealer usually needs new products on the shelf fast, without sinking capital into engineering. ODM fits this well. Take machines from the strength range: a Lat Pull Down, a Smith Machine, or a standard Power Rack already exist as mature designs. Rebranding them with a new color and a logo is quick, and the tooling is already proven. A distributor facing an urgent order can rely on ODM to keep a shipment on schedule.

A brand entering its growth phase, building its own intellectual property, tends to lean the other way. Here OEM makes sense. Locking down a supply chain and owning a distinct product design builds a barrier that competitors cannot simply copy off a catalog. Free-weight items illustrate the point. Hex dumbbells and polyurethane barbells often carry brand-specific grip shapes, weight markings, and finishes, so these usually call for drawing-based, deeply customized production rather than a quick color swap.

In short, catalog machines suit rebadge-and-adjust ODM work, while signature free-weight and bespoke pieces reward the OEM route.

Where Things Quietly Go Wrong

Both models carry traps worth naming plainly.

On the ODM side, appearance and structural patent ownership is the item people skip. A design supplied by the factory may carry rights the factory keeps. Clarify in writing who owns what before the first order, especially if the product might later anchor a proprietary line. Confusion here surfaces at the worst moment, usually when a brand tries to move that design elsewhere.

On the OEM side, a small trial run demands close checks. Inspect the weld beads on load-bearing joints. Confirm the tubing spec, for example a 75--75--3mm main frame on a rack, since wall thickness affects both safety and feel. Check the electrostatic powder coating for even coverage and adhesion. And insist on a pre-shipment report with photos before releasing the balance. A first OEM batch reveals whether the factory read the drawings correctly, so treat it as the audit it is.

These are not exotic requirements. They are the difference between a product that survives daily commercial use and one that returns as a warranty claim.

Closing: A Simple Way To Decide

The choice rarely needs a long spreadsheet. It usually comes down to a few honest checks.

  • Look at how distinct the product must be. A near-standard rack that only needs a logo points toward ODM; a piece meant to define the brand points toward OEM.
  • Weigh the cost of speed against the cost of control. Getting to market this quarter and owning the design outright pull in opposite directions.
  • Read the factory before the design. A first small order tells more about weld quality, coating, and communication than any brochure.

A sensible path for many newcomers is to start with a small ODM trial, perhaps ten units, to test both the market and the factory, then shift to OEM once the direction firms up. That sequence keeps early risk low while leaving room to build something proprietary later.
